About This Property
This is a luxurious 2 bedroom, 2 bathroom unfurnished condo/apartment in the heart of the Highlands, overlooking the treetops of Cherokee Park, two blocks off Bardstown Rd. Rent, includes all utilities and provides for one indoor parking space. Laundry room on the 1st floor with free use of (new) washers and dryers, basement storage space, and a doorman/elevator operator on duty 24/7. Hardwood; updated kitchen with dishwasher, new high end stove and an incredible amount of closet space throughout the apartment. Original historic Rookwood tiling in both bathrooms. Pets considered. Commodore Condominiums
Commodore Condominiums, designed by the renowned architectural firm Joseph & Joseph, stands as an 11-story testament to early 20th-century elegance. Completed in 1929, this historic building is located in the vibrant Cherokee Seneca neighborhood of Louisville. With 62 units, the Commodore offers a blend of classic architectural details and contemporary updates, making it a sought-after residence for those who appreciate both history and modern amenities.

Louisville is the largest city in Kentucky, resting alongside the Ohio River on the Kentucky-Indiana border. The architecture in Louisville is a mix of old and new, with historic neighborhoods comprised of Victorian houses and towering skyscrapers scattered throughout the downtown area, many of which contain upscale apartments and condos available for rent.
The amenities in Louisville are just as diverse as the architecture. Renting in Louisville affords you the opportunity to see the famous Kentucky Derby at Churchill Downs, learn more about a boxing legend at the Muhammad Ali Center, and meet a range of animals at the Louisville Zoo. The city’s award-winning restaurant scene is an exemplary display of Southern cooking. Just outside the city lies the Louisville Mega Cavern, a vast underground space offering a broad range of adventurous attractions.
